Agricultural Extension and Rural Sociology


Agricultural Extension and Rural Sociology examines social dynamics in rural communities and designs extension programs that reflect cultural and societal needs. Additionally, the minimum requirement for applicants seeking admission to the Agricultural Extension and Rural Sociology department under Faculty of Agriculture, is five (5) credits (C5 and higher) in their SSCE subjects, including the following:


  • English Language,


  • Mathematics,


  • Biology/Agricultural Science,


  • Chemistry and


  • any one (1) of Geography, Physics and Economics.


Business Administration and Management (BAM)


Business Administration and Management (BAM) equips students with managerial, leadership, and financial skills for effective organizational performance. Furthermore, candidates aspiring to gain admission into Business Administration and Management (BAM) department under Faculty of Administration, should at least obtain five (5) credit (C5 and above) passes in their SSCE subjects including:


  • English Language (not Literature in English)


  • Mathematics


  • Any three subjects from the following: Economics / Commerce, Business Methods, Principles of Accounts, Literature in English, Geography, Office Practice, Biology / Agricultural Science, Chemistry, Physics, History / Government, Typewriting, and Shorthand


Chemical / Petrochemical Engineering


Chemical / Petrochemical Engineering focuses on converting raw materials into useful products through processes used in chemical manufacturing and petroleum refining. Moreover, candidates aspiring to gain admission into Chemical / Petrochemical Engineering department under Faculty of Engineering / Technology, should at least obtain five (5) credit (C5 and above) passes in their SSCE subjects including:


  • English Language,


  • Physics,


  • Mathematics,


  • Chemistry and


  • any other relevant subject.


Crop Production Technology


Crop Production Technology trains students in modern crop farming methods, including mechanization, irrigation, and precision agriculture technologies. Moreover, a minimum of five (5) credit passes (C5 and higher) in their SSCE subjects, including the following, are required for applicants to the Crop Production Technology department under Faculty of Agriculture.


  • English Language,


  • Chemistry,


  • Biology/Agricultural Science,


  • Mathematics,


  • one Science/Social Science subject and


  • at least a pass in Physics.

Livestock Production Technology


Livestock Production Technology focuses on animal breeding, nutrition, and health management to improve livestock productivity and sustainability. Furthermore, the minimum requirement for applicants seeking admission to the Livestock Production Technology department under Faculty of Agriculture, is five (5) credits (C5 and higher) in their SSCE subjects, including the following:


  • English Language,


  • Mathematics,


  • Chemistry,


  • Physics and


  • Biology / Agricultural Science.


Zoology


Zoology studies animal biology, physiology, and behavior, supporting research in ecology and biodiversity. Moreover, candidates seeking admission into the Zoology department under Faculty of Science, must have at least five (5) credits (C5 and more) in their SSCE disciplines, including the following:


  • English Language,


  • Mathematics,


  • Biology and


  • two (2) other Science subject.
